baki

BA-ki

Meaning

to remain, be left over, or stay behind; also, a remainder or a neutral, impartial person.

Good to know

used both as a verb (to remain) and a noun (remainder), including the mathematical remainder in subtraction.

Examples

  • Chakula kilichobaki kiliwekwa jokofuni.The leftover food was put in the fridge.
  • Alibaki nyumbani wakati wenzake wakienda.He stayed home while his friends went.
  • Baki ya hesabu hiyo ni tano.The remainder of that sum is five.
  • Yeye ni mtu baki, hachukui upande wowote.He is a neutral person, he doesn't take sides.
